ul.menu li {
	position: relative;
	display: block;
	float: left;
}

ul.menu li a {
	display: block;
	float: left;
	line-height: 22px;
	text-decoration: none;
	text-transform: uppercase;
	color: #eeebe4;
	padding: 0 3px;
}

ul.menu li:hover a {
	background: #bfbaab;
	color: #4c4330;
}

ul.menu li ul {
	position: absolute;
	top: 21px;
	left: 0;
	margin: 0;
	padding: 0;
	visibility: hidden;
}

ul.menu li:hover ul {
	visibility: visible;
}

ul.menu li ul li {
	margin: 0;
	padding: 0;
	height: auto;
}

ul.menu li ul li, ul.menu li ul li a {
	width: 100%;
}

ul.menu li ul li a {
	padding: 0 0 0 10px;
	border-bottom: 1px #6d6a4b dotted;
}

ul.menu li ul li a, ul.menu li:hover ul li a {
	background: #aa9b72;
	height: auto;
	text-transform: none;
}

ul.menu li ul li:hover a, ul.menu li:hover ul li:hover a {
	background: #bfbaab url(/images/menu_bullet.png) left center no-repeat;
	color: #4c4330;
}

ul.menu li li ul {
	left: 95%;
}

/* Fix IE. Hide from IE Mac \*/
ul.menu {
	behavior:url(/csshover2.htc);
}

ul.menu li ul {
	width: 10em;
}

ul.menu li ul li {
	background: #aa9b72;
}

ul.menu li ul li a:hover {
	background: #bfbaab url(/images/menu_bullet.png) left center no-repeat;
}
/* End */
